Transaction 42660fc31f9f7b6ab694d1605605c7fba04b1db1cd52f6051438f8438356033e

1 Input
2 Outputs
  • 42660fc31f9f7b6ab694d1605605c7fba04b1db1cd52f6051438f8438356033e:0
  • value  208467
    address  1MRqbpCw4wJBjCH3PWxjB3YdmSe5LXJKAU
  • 42660fc31f9f7b6ab694d1605605c7fba04b1db1cd52f6051438f8438356033e:1
  • value  5132388
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D